14 having canceled (A)the certificate of debt consisting of decrees against us, which was hostile to us; and (B)He has taken it out of the way, having nailed it to the cross. 15 When He had [a](C)disarmed the (D)rulers and authorities, He (E)made a public display of them, having (F)triumphed over them through [b]Him.

16 Therefore, no one is to [c](G)act as your judge in regard to (H)food and (I)drink, or in respect to a (J)festival or a (K)new moon, or a (L)Sabbath [d]day— 17 things which are only a (M)shadow of what is to come; but the [e]substance [f]belongs to Christ.

14 having canceled the charge of our legal indebtedness,(A) which stood against us and condemned us; he has taken it away, nailing it to the cross.(B) 15 And having disarmed the powers and authorities,(C) he made a public spectacle of them, triumphing over them(D) by the cross.[a]

Freedom From Human Rules

16 Therefore do not let anyone judge you(E) by what you eat or drink,(F) or with regard to a religious festival,(G) a New Moon celebration(H) or a Sabbath day.(I) 17 These are a shadow of the things that were to come;(J) the reality, however, is found in Christ.
